"It's indeed surprising that replacing the elementary particle with a string leads to such a big change in things. I'm tempted to say that it has to do with the fuzziness it introduces"

“Replacing the elementary particle with a string” isn’t a cosmetic upgrade. A point has no internal scale; it invites infinities when interactions probe arbitrarily short distances. A string, by contrast, has length, vibration, and thus a built-in “smearing” of interactions. Calling it “fuzziness” is Witten’s deliberately human word for a technical fact: extendedness acts like a regulator, softening the ultraviolet catastrophes that haunt point-like theories. The “big change” is less about adding a new object than about changing what it even means to collide, to localize, to ask a question at zero distance.
The “I’m tempted to say” matters, too. It signals intellectual modesty while nudging the reader toward an explanatory style that string theory often resists: no single mechanism, just a network of consequences (dualities, new symmetries, unexpected links to geometry) that make the theory feel less like an invention and more like a discovery. Witten is hinting that physics sometimes advances by accepting blur where we demanded precision, and finding that the blur is not ignorance but structure.
